The Phenomenon of the Eras Tour
The Eras Tour quickly became more than just a concert series. It evolved into a cultural event that united millions of fans across continents. Each performance celebrated different chapters of Swift’s musical career, allowing audiences to relive the songs, memories, and emotions that defined various periods of their own lives.
The scale of the tour was unprecedented. Stadiums sold out within minutes. Cities experienced economic boosts from the influx of visitors. Social media platforms became flooded with videos, reactions, and emotional stories from attendees.
However, behind the dazzling lights, elaborate stage designs, and marathon-length performances was an artist carrying an enormous workload. Delivering such a massive production night after night required extraordinary physical stamina, mental focus, and emotional energy.
For a tour of the Eras Tour’s magnitude, the demands are immense. Travel schedules can be exhausting. Rehearsals are rigorous. Performers must maintain vocal health, physical fitness, and emotional resilience while constantly being in the public eye.
